Who consumed ready meals, and dies a little more

Who takes highly processed foods, has an increased risk of mortality: a French long-term study of tens of thousands of people. A clear causal relationship could not show the researchers, however, also other factors could play a role.

involved In the study from 2009 to 2017, a total of 45 000 French people who were 45 years or older. Every six months the subjects had to indicate for a period of three days, what have you taken.

At the end of the investigation period 600 study participants had died. The analysis of the data showed that a ten per cent increased consumption of ready meals or other highly processed food was associated with a 15 percent increased risk of death. The researchers report on Monday in the U.S. journal "Jama Internal Medicine".

Only a mosaic stone in the research

The researchers stressed, however, that in such an observational study, no clear conclusions about cause and effect. Study Director Mathilde Trouvier warned to dramatize in front of it"". The investigation was a further mosaic stone in the research on the impact of highly processed foods on health. As a damaging factor the scientists suspect the additives that are included in the ready-made meals.

The study also shows that such products would be increasingly consumed by single people or people with low income and low educational degrees, said Nita Forouhi, from the University of Cambridge. Such people are affected due to a General unhealthy life style already of a higher risk of death. "Against this injustice, more must be done." (nag/sda)
